Output 86e1f65d52afdfb6954d5cc09243d30837947890b0babe84545ead03d21af2e5:2

value
3521859
script pubkey
OP_0 OP_PUSHBYTES_20 10e132e201634442633177aa8172cd802dba9c50
address
ltc1qzrsn9cspvdzyyce3w74gzukdsqkm48zs47hax6
transaction
86e1f65d52afdfb6954d5cc09243d30837947890b0babe84545ead03d21af2e5
spent
true